6 dead, 15 injured in Davao accident
DAVAO CITY -- Six people died while 15 others were injured when the truck conveying them home from Daliaon plantation, Toril, Davao City, lost its brake and crashed into a hill Friday afternoon.
The victims are reportedly workers at Illuminada farms in Daliaon.
The truck, bearing plate number GLA-854, was on its way to deliver chicken manure to the farm.
Dead are Michael Inson, 16, Jerry Lloyd Mejos, 17, Elmar Garde, 17, Gaudencio Vernez, 42 and son Jayson, 17, and Randy Polvurosa, 17, all of Sitio Bago Saka, Barangay Bago Gallera, Talomo District.
The bodies were brought to the St. John Hospital in Toril, except for Polvurosa's body, which was brought to the Davao Medical Center (DMC).
Police report revealed the minors died when they jumped off the truck and slammed into boulders or were staked by jutting pieces of wood instead.
Meanwhile, still recuperating at the DMC are Louie Calimot, 17, Vernel Layson, 16, Victor Vales, 46, Manuel Barbanida, 20, Jiouanie Alcala, 24, Natahaniel Inson, 13, Alfred Barbanida, 16, Noel Polvurosa, 19, Wilmar Barbanida, 18, Romeo Sumalinog, 17, Rodolfo Moreno, 34, Besinardo Alcala, 19, Felixberto Polvurosa, 16, Francisco Barbanida, 38 and the driver of the truck, Apolinario Agapito, 44.
